I am a little worried that our classroom will be too hot late in the spring and want to know now, so proper steps can be taken to make sure the room is comfortable. You can help by performing the energy balance of a full classroom. We have about 36 people in our class (including the instructor). The building is cooling by air conditioning units that provide 4 kW pf cooling capacity. Each person dissipates about 350 kJ/h. There are about 30 light bulbs in the room, each with a rating of about 40 W. The rate of heat transfer through the walls and windows to the room will probably be around 16,000 kJ/h on an average spring day. Determine the total number of air conditioning units needed to maintain the room at 22 degreeC.

Solution

The Heat Input from 36 people

Qp=36*(350 /3600) =3.5 KW

Heat Transfer through the walls

Qw=(16000/3600)=4.44 KW

Heat transfer from light bulbs

Qb=30*40 =1200 Watts =1.2 KW

So the total heat Input

Q=3.5+4.44+1.2 =9.14 KW

The Heat removal comes from Air conditioning units at 4 KW for each.So Number of air conditioning units needed to maintain temperature at 22oC is

N =9.14/4 =2.286 = 3 units (approx)
